Understanding the Impact of Loneliness on Elderly Mental Health
Loneliness among the elderly is a growing concern, as it can significantly impact mental well-being. The silence and isolation that often accompany aging can lead to profound feelings of loneliness, which, in turn, may contribute to depression, anxiety, and cognitive decline. Elderly companion services play a crucial role in combating these issues by providing meaningful social interaction and emotional support tailored to the unique needs of seniors.
Understanding the effects of loneliness is the first step towards addressing it effectively. Research suggests that regular companionship can enhance overall mental health, improve mood, and even slow down cognitive deterioration. Elderly companion services offer a dedicated solution, connecting older adults with trained companions who can engage in activities, share stories, and provide a listening ear, thus fostering a sense of belonging and purpose.
The Benefits of Companion Services for Seniors
Elderly Companion Services offer a range of benefits that significantly contribute to the mental well-being of seniors. One of the most notable advantages is the provision of social interaction, which is crucial for combating loneliness and isolation—common issues among the elderly population. Through regular visits from companions, seniors gain opportunities to engage in conversations, participate in activities, and maintain a sense of connection with others.
These services also provide emotional support and encourage active engagement in daily life. Companions can assist with various tasks, ensuring seniors remain independent while offering companionship when needed. This helps alleviate stress and anxiety by providing company during meals, outings, or even simple leisure activities. As a result, Elderly Companion Services play a vital role in enhancing the overall quality of life for seniors, fostering mental stimulation, and promoting a positive outlook.
Creating a Supportive Environment: Tips for Choosing the Right Elderly Companion
When considering elderly companion services, creating a supportive environment is paramount for positive mental well-being. The right companion should possess empathy and patience, understanding the unique needs and challenges of the individual they support. They should be able to engage in meaningful conversations, offer emotional support, and encourage social interaction to combat feelings of loneliness and isolation.
Choosing a companion involves considering factors like personality compatibility, shared interests, and the ability to respect personal boundaries. It’s important to look for someone who can provide not just company but also assistance with daily tasks, ensuring safety and comfort in their own home. This supportive environment fosters mental well-being, enhances overall quality of life, and promotes independence for seniors.
